3 sätt att installera deb-filer på Ubuntu [och ta bort dem senare]

author
6 minutes, 5 seconds Read

Denna nybörjarartikel förklarar hur man installerar deb-paket på Ubuntu. Den visar också hur du tar bort dessa deb-paket i efterhand.

Detta är ytterligare en artikel i vår serie om Ubuntu för nybörjare. Om du är helt ny på Ubuntu kanske du undrar hur du installerar program.

Det enklaste sättet är att använda Ubuntu Software Center. Sök efter ett program efter namn och installera det därifrån.

Livet skulle vara för enkelt om du kunde hitta alla program i Software Center. Så är tyvärr inte fallet.

Vissa programvaror finns tillgängliga via ”deb”-paket. Dessa är arkiverade filer som slutar med tillägget .deb.

Du kan tänka på .deb-filer som .exe-filer i Windows. Du dubbelklickar på .exe-filen och den startar installationsproceduren i Windows. Deb-paket är i stort sett likadana.

Dessa deb-paket hittar du i nedladdningssektionen på en programvaruleverantörs webbplats. Om du till exempel vill installera Google Chrome på Ubuntu kan du ladda ner deb-paketet Chrome från dess webbplats.

Nu uppstår frågan: hur installerar man deb-filer? Det finns flera sätt att installera deb-paket på Ubuntu. Jag ska visa dem ett efter ett i den här handledningen.

Installation av .deb-filer på Ubuntu och Debianbaserade Linuxdistributioner

Du kan välja ett GUI-verktyg eller ett kommandoradsverktyg för att installera ett deb-paket. Valet är ditt.

Låt oss fortsätta och se hur du installerar deb-filer.

Metod 1: Använd standardprogramvarucentret

Den enklaste metoden är att använda standardprogramvarucentret i Ubuntu. Det finns inget speciellt att göra här. Gå helt enkelt till mappen där du laddade ner .deb-filen (vanligtvis mappen Downloads) och dubbelklicka på filen.

Dubbelklicka på den nedladdade .deb-filen för att starta installationen

Det kommer att öppna programvarucentret, där du bör se alternativet att installera programvaran. Allt du behöver göra är att trycka på installationsknappen och ange ditt inloggningslösenord.

Installationen av deb-filen kommer att utföras via Software Center

Se, det är ännu enklare än att installera från en .exe-fil i Windows, eller hur?

Felsökning: Dubbelklicka på deb-filen öppnas inte i Software Center i Ubuntu 20.04

Dubbelklicka på deb-filen i Ubuntu 20.04 öppnar filen i arkivhanteraren istället för i Software Center.

Det här är konstigt men kan enkelt åtgärdas. Allt du behöver göra är att högerklicka på deb-filen och gå till alternativet Öppna med. Här väljer du öppna med Software Install som standardalternativ.

Deb-filinstallation fixar Ubuntu

Metod 2: Använd Gdebi-applikationen för att installera deb-paket med beroenden

Ja, livet skulle vara mycket enklare om allting alltid gick smidigt. Men det är inte livet som vi känner det.

Nu när du vet att .deb-filer enkelt kan installeras via Software Center, låt mig berätta om det beroendefel som du kan stöta på med vissa paket.

Det som händer är att ett program kan vara beroende av en annan programvara (till exempel bibliotek). När utvecklaren förbereder deb-paketet för dig kan han/hon anta att ditt system redan har den programvaran.

Men om så inte är fallet och ditt system inte har de nödvändiga programvarorna kommer du att stöta på det ökända ”beroendefelet”.

Mjukvarucentralen kan inte hantera sådana fel på egen hand, så du måste använda ett annat verktyg som heter gdebi.

gdebi är ett lättviktigt GUI-program med det enda syftet att installera deb-paket.

Det identifierar beroenden och försöker installera dessa tillsammans med .deb-filerna.

Bildkredit: Xmodulo

Personligen föredrar jag gdebi framför programvarucentralen när det gäller installation av deb-filer. Det är ett lättviktigt program så installationen verkar snabbare. Du kan läsa i detalj om hur du använder gDebi och gör det till standard för att installera DEB-paket.

Du kan installera gdebi från programvarucentralen eller med hjälp av kommandot nedan:

sudo apt install gdebi

Metod 3: Installera .deb-filer på kommandoraden med hjälp av dpkg

Om du vill installera deb-paket på kommandoraden kan du använda antingen apt-kommandot eller dpkg-kommandot. Kommandot apt använder egentligen dpkg-kommandot under det, men apt är mer populärt och enklare att använda.

Om du vill använda apt-kommandot för deb-filer använder du det så här:

sudo apt install path_to_deb_file

Om du vill använda dpkg-kommandot för att installera deb-paket gör du så här:

sudo dpkg -i path_to_deb_file

I båda kommandona ska du ersätta path_to_deb_file med sökvägen och namnet på den deb-fil som du har laddat ner.

Installation av deb-filer med hjälp av dpkg-kommandot på Ubuntu

Om du får ett beroendefel när du installerar deb-paketen kan du använda följande kommando för att åtgärda det:

sudo apt install -f

Hur man tar bort deb-paket

Att ta bort ett deb-paket är inte heller någon stor sak. Och nej, du behöver inte den ursprungliga deb-filen som du använde för att installera programmet.

Metod 1: Ta bort deb-paket med hjälp av apt-kommandot

Allt du behöver är namnet på det program som du har installerat och sedan kan du använda apt eller dpkg för att ta bort det programmet.

sudo apt remove program_name

Nu kommer frågan, hur hittar du det exakta programnamnet som du måste använda i remove-kommandot? Kommandot apt har en lösning även för det.

Du kan hitta en lista över alla installerade filer med kommandot apt, men att manuellt gå igenom detta kommer att vara jobbigt. Så du kan använda kommandot grep för att söka efter ditt paket.

Till exempel installerade jag programmet AppGrid i föregående avsnitt, men om jag vill ta reda på det exakta programnamnet kan jag använda något som detta:

sudo apt list --installed | grep grid

Detta kommer att ge mig alla paket som har grid i sitt namn, och därifrån kan jag få fram det exakta programnamnet.

apt list --installed | grep grid
WARNING: apt does not have a stable CLI interface. Use with caution in scripts.
appgrid/now 0.298 all

Som du kan se är ett program kallat appgrid installerat. Nu kan du använda detta programnamn med kommandot apt remove.

Metod 2: Ta bort deb-paket med hjälp av kommandot dpkg

Du kan använda dpkg för att hitta det installerade programmets namn:

dpkg -l | grep grid

Utmatningen kommer att ge alla installerade paket som har grid i sitt namn.

dpkg -l | grep grid
ii appgrid 0.298 all Discover and install apps for Ubuntu

ii i utmatningen av kommandot ovan betyder att paketet har installerats på rätt sätt.

Nu när du har programnamnet kan du använda kommandot dpkg för att ta bort det:

dpkg -r program_name

Tip: Uppdatering av deb-paket
Vissa deb-paket (som Chrome) tillhandahåller uppdateringar genom systemuppdateringar, men för de flesta andra programvaror måste du ta bort det befintliga programmet och installera den nyare versionen.

Jag hoppas att den här guiden för nybörjare har hjälpt dig att installera deb-paket på Ubuntu. Jag lade till borttagningsdelen så att du kan få bättre kontroll över de program du installerat.

Gillar du vad du läste? Dela den gärna med andra.

352Shares
  • Facebook228
  • Twitter19
  • LinkedIn2
  • Reddit0
  • Pocket1

Similar Posts

Lämna ett svar

Din e-postadress kommer inte publiceras.